You know that energy is “power over time”? Speed of light yes, but it has to be exposed long enough to transmit/be exposed to a certain amount of energy. If the piezo electric mirror switches between the following states there is no limitation because of the speed of light:

IR Power sensor ↔ IR sensor line (for each line as long as the incoming power is uncritical)
IR Power sensor ↔ Absorber block or line skip (if the incoming power exceeds the allowed limit for the line)

Between every line it switches to the power sensor to check if the incoming power exceeds the limit and only if it’s safe it directs the incoming IR radiation onto the IR sensor line, otherwise to either the absorber block or it skips to the next line and the cycle repeats. This would also equal a mechanical shutter effect (a shutter is necessary anyway for line-scan devices). Technically this is no witchcraft and the speed of light has nothing to do with it.

The only crititcal moment would be when the line gets redirected and in exactly that moment the LDIRCM hits the sensor, but then the exposure time would also just be just a few microseconds before the mirror switches to the power sensor again.
